GEELY AUTO Uzbekistan is looking for a Sales Administrator who will be responsible for sales planning, production order placement, coordination of vehicle deliveries to dealers, and preparation of operational reports.
Key Responsibilities:- Participate in vehicle sales planning for the Uzbekistan market.
- Place orders in the production system and monitor order confirmation.
- Support the preparation and signing of contracts with the manufacturer.
- Prepare regular reports on sales, orders, and inventory levels.
- Monitor competitors’ prices, discounts, promotions, and market offers.
- Prepare vehicle supply orders from the distributor’s warehouse to dealers.
- Monitor dealer payments and coordinate vehicle shipments from the warehouse.
- Communicate with headquarters and prepare regular operational reports.
- Prepare reports for dealers on bonus programs.
- Verify bonus calculations and monitor bonus payments to dealers.
- Review bank reports on issued auto loans.
- Prepare payment data and coordinate bank commission payments with the Finance Department.
